De novo transcriptome assembly and analysis to identify potential gene targets for RNAi-mediated control of the tomato Leafminer (tuta Absoluta)

Providing double-stranded RNA (dsRNA) to insects has been proven to silence target genes, and this approach has emerged as a potential method to control agricultural pests by engineering plants to express insect dsRNAs.
